基于layui-admin构建企业级后台管理系统完整指南
【免费下载链接】layui-admin基于layui2.x的带后台的通用管理系统项目地址: https://gitcode.com/gh_mirrors/la/layui-admin
还在为开发复杂的企业管理系统而烦恼吗?面对繁琐的权限配置、重复的业务模块开发,很多开发者都感到无从下手。layui-admin基于Spring Boot和layui框架,为你提供了一套完整的解决方案,让新手也能快速搭建专业的管理平台。
🎯 项目核心价值与特色
layui-admin不仅仅是一个后台管理系统,更是一套成熟的企业级开发框架。它解决了传统开发中的多个痛点:
传统开发困境:
- 权限系统重复开发,耗费大量时间精力
- 前后端分离配置复杂,调试难度大
- 界面设计不统一,用户体验差
layui-admin解决方案:
- 开箱即用的完整权限体系
- 基于Spring Boot + layui的稳定技术栈
- 现代化界面设计,操作流畅自然
系统采用深色自然风格设计,营造专业稳重的登录体验
🚀 快速上手体验
环境准备与项目获取
首先确保你的开发环境满足基本要求:
- JDK 1.8及以上版本
- Maven 3.x构建工具
- MySQL或Oracle数据库
获取项目代码非常简单:
git clone https://gitcode.com/gh_mirrors/la/layui-admin数据库配置与初始化
编辑配置文件,设置数据库连接参数:
- 数据库地址和端口配置
- 用户名和密码安全设置
- 连接池优化参数调整
前后端联调配置
修改前端配置文件中的API地址,确保前后端正常通信。系统采用RESTful API设计,接口清晰易用。
项目启动运行
直接运行LayuiAdminStartUp.java的main方法,访问系统登录地址即可开始使用。
🏗️ 系统架构深度解析
多层次权限控制机制
layui-admin采用精细化的权限管理体系,从菜单访问权限到按钮操作权限,实现全方位的安全控制。
核心权限模块:
- 用户管理:完整的用户信息维护
- 角色管理:灵活的角色权限分配
- 菜单管理:动态菜单配置界面
安全认证体系
系统基于Apache Shiro实现安全认证,支持多角色权限分配,确保系统数据安全可靠。
模块化扩展设计
layui-admin采用高度模块化的架构设计,便于二次开发和功能扩展。开发者可以按照现有架构快速添加新的业务模块。
💼 实际应用场景展示
企业内部办公系统
layui-admin特别适合构建OA办公自动化、CRM客户关系管理等内部管理平台。其完善的权限体系能够满足不同部门的差异化需求。
电商平台后台管理
系统支持商品管理、订单处理、用户信息维护等电商核心功能,帮助企业快速搭建专业的电商管理后台。
内容管理系统
对于需要管理大量内容的场景,layui-admin提供了完整的文章管理、媒体资源管理等功能模块。
🔧 进阶使用技巧
性能优化策略
- 数据库查询优化与索引配置
- 静态资源缓存机制设置
- 系统运行参数合理调优
生产环境部署
- 使用Maven打包为可执行jar文件
- 配置合适的JVM参数提升性能
- 部署到Linux或Windows服务器环境
🛠️ 常见问题解决方案
登录权限异常:检查用户角色配置和菜单权限分配数据查询问题:验证SQL语句和分页配置系统响应缓慢:优化数据库索引和服务器配置
📈 项目优势总结
相比于从零开始开发后台管理系统,layui-admin提供了以下显著优势:
- 开发效率大幅提升:基于成熟框架,快速搭建功能模块
- 代码质量有保障:规范的架构设计,便于后续维护升级
- 学习成本显著降低:完善的文档说明,新手也能轻松上手
layui-admin作为一个经过实际项目验证的开源项目,在系统稳定性、功能完整性和用户体验方面都有着出色表现。无论你是想要学习企业级系统开发,还是需要快速搭建实际项目,这都是一个值得尝试的选择。
开始你的layui-admin之旅,用专业的技术方案构建高效的管理系统!
【免费下载链接】layui-admin基于layui2.x的带后台的通用管理系统项目地址: https://gitcode.com/gh_mirrors/la/layui-admin
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考